About The Book

This book opens up new directions in judgment and decision making research. Our society and academic research have largely neglected the fact that sound judgment and decision making are the crux of many professions. This volume explores metacognitive processes as an enabler of competence at decision making. Offering a new analysis of competence by understanding and communicating what professional decision makers do this book provides valuable contributions to the judgement/decision making field as well as the professional community at large.
